Why Choose Chickpeas?

Chickpeas, also known as garbanzo beans, have been a staple in many cultures for centuries. They are beloved not just because of their hearty texture and nutty flavor, but also for the numerous health benefits they bring to your table. Packed with proteins, fiber, and critical vitamins and minerals, chickpeas are a powerhouse addition to any meal. They are highly versatile, fitting seamlessly into salads, soups, stews, and curries.

Due to their health benefits and their ability to adapt to various culinary applications, learning how to cook soaked chickpeas in a pressure cooker is a skill worth mastering. With this technique, you can enjoy a healthy, homemade meal without resorting to the high-sodium canned versions available in stores.

Benefits of Using a Pressure Cooker

The pressure cooker brings both convenience and quality to the kitchen. While traditional cooking methods can take hours to transform dried chickpeas into a tender, edible delight, a pressure cooker can do the job in as little as 20-30 minutes. This time-saving potential makes it an invaluable tool for a busy household.

Pressure cookers also have the added benefit of preserving nutrients. The high-pressure cooking environment, along with shorter cooking times, ensures that fewer vitamins and minerals are lost during the process. When mastering how to cook soaked chickpeas in a pressure cooker, you not only save time but also boost the nutritional quality of your meals.

Prepping Your Chickpeas

Before diving into the pressure-cooking process, a bit of preparation is needed. The initial step involves properly soaking the chickpeas. Although soaking is optional, it is highly recommended for several reasons. First and foremost, soaking reduces cooking time significantly. It also helps to break down some complex sugars that make chickpeas hard to digest for some. Consequently, soaking can also lead to better texture and flavor.

Steps for Soaking Chickpeas

2. Place the rinsed chickpeas in a large bowl or container and cover them with plenty of water. The chickpeas will absorb water and expand, so aim for at least three times the amount of water to chickpeas.

3. Add a bit of salt to the water if desired; this can help to soften the chickpeas and enhance their flavor.

4. Let the chickpeas soak for at least 8 hours or overnight for optimal results.

5. After soaking, drain and rinse the chickpeas thoroughly.

Cooking Chickpeas in a Pressure Cooker

Now that your chickpeas are soaked and ready, it's time to start cooking. Follow these detailed steps to achieve the perfect texture and flavor:

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Start by adding your soaked chickpeas into the pressure cooker. Be sure to discard any leftover soaking water and use fresh water or broth.

2. Add the required amount of water or broth. As a rule of thumb, use about 4 cups for every 1 cup of dried chickpeas. This ratio ensures that the chickpeas are adequately submerged and can absorb enough water to become tender.

3. Season with salt and add any additional ingredients like garlic, bay leaves, or herbs to enhance taste.

4. Secure the lid of the pressure cooker and set it for high pressure. Most electric pressure cookers will have a pre-set bean or legume function, simplifying the process.

5. Set the cooking time. For soaked chickpeas, 15-20 minutes on high pressure is typically sufficient. However, if you prefer an even softer texture, you may extend the cooking time by 5-10 minutes.

6. Once the cooking time has elapsed, allow for natural pressure release. This means letting the pressure cooker cool down and release steam on its own, which can take about 10-15 minutes. This step helps retain the beans' texture.

7. Carefully remove the lid after the pressure has fully released. Test a few chickpeas to see if they are done to your liking. If they need more time, you can cook under pressure for another 5-10 minutes.

Serving and Storing Your Chickpeas

Now that your chickpeas are perfectly cooked, the possibilities are endless. You can use them right away in your favorite recipes, from hummus and salads to stews and casseroles. Don't let those lovely beans go to waste; here are some tips on how to store them:

Storing Your Chickpeas

1. Drain any excess liquid from the cooked chickpeas. This step is especially crucial if you prefer firmer beans.

2. Allow the chickpeas to cool completely before storing them. Transferring hot beans to the refrigerator can cause condensation and unwanted sogginess.

3. Place the cooled chickpeas in an airtight container. They can be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week.

4. For longer storage, you can freeze the cooked chickpeas. Simply spread them in a single layer on a baking sheet to freeze individually before transferring them to a freezer-safe container or bag.

Serving Ideas

Chickpeas are a culinary chameleon, capable of transforming into various dishes. Here are some delightful ways to incorporate them into your meals:

  • Hummus: Blend cooked chickpeas with tahini, lemon juice, garlic, and olive oil to make a classic Middle-Eastern dip.
  • Salads: Toss chickpeas with fresh vegetables, herbs, and a light vinaigrette for a protein-packed salad.
  • Curries: Add chickpeas to your favorite curry recipe for a hearty and nutritious boost.
  • Soups: Include chickpeas in soups and stews to add texture and flavor.
  • Snacks: Roast chickpeas with your choice of spices for a crunchy and healthy snack.
